Project Overview
A flagship educational infrastructure project to expand the campus capacity of the Tanzania Institute of Accountancy (TIA) in Dar es Salaam. The project included new lecture halls, administrative wings, and student recreation areas.
KAICON acted as the primary civil contractor, handling everything from deep foundation works to multi-story structural framing and final interior finishing.
The Challenge
Working within a highly congested, active campus environment required stringent health, safety, and environmental (HSE) controls to protect students and faculty while managing constant heavy vehicle logistics.
KAICON's Solution & Impact
We implemented a phased construction methodology with off-hours heavy logistics scheduling. The facility was delivered with zero lost-time injuries (LTI) and has successfully expanded TIA's daily student capacity by 2,500.
